It's nice to see more of carden's childhood. It's interesting to see the reason that he ended up the way that he is and his point of view is the one that I didn't think I would get to see. However I do not like Carden. I don't care what tragic backstory they give him I do not like him so grain of salt.

This book was different from the trilogy. It felt calmer but still had drama. I really enjoyed getting a slight picture of Cardan's side. I'm falling deeper in-love with Cardan though. Probably not good. I loved the art style as well!
